On Sat, 2 Apr 2016, Christian Haul wrote:

> I have just discovered that stepping into JRE classes with a debugger does not
> allow inspecting variable states, the debugger complains that classes are built
> without "-g" option.

They are built without any -g option. Some (jaxp, for example) use -g
but not all. Looking at jdk/make/Setup.gmk, from jdk.tar.xz, the calls
of the SetupJavaCompiler macro are all missing -g from FLAGS. The CORBA
stuff is also built without it.

There’s no single variable used by all of them where we could just add
-g so this… is going to be tricky. Ideally, you’d ask upstream to change
this for the next 8u? Is this possible?
